Zoe Saldaña talks about the surprising similarities and differences between her Guardians of the Galaxy character, Gamora, and her Avatar: The Way Of Water character, Neytiri. Family is at the heart of the Avatar and Guardians of the Galaxy franchises, with both Gamora and Neytiri facing hardships and war before creating their own families. While The Guardians of the Galaxy story is coming to a close with Guardians of the Galaxy Vol. 3, Avatar is just beginning with the upcoming sequel Avatar: The Way Of Water.

In an exclusive interview with Screen Rant, Saldaña revealed how each of her leading characters, Gamora and Neytiri, feel about family. She shared that both have had very traumatic pasts, but they have been impacted differently as a result. Unlike Gamora, Neytiri is not a voice of reason. Instead, she describes the character as “an instinct.”
